Crafting Applications : From Idea to Realization

The process of building software is a intricate undertaking, moving far beyond a simple notion. It commences with identifying a requirement and moves through phases of architecture, programming , rigorous testing , and finally, deployment . Each stage requires careful attention and collaboration between engineers, designers , and users, ensuring a successful application that meets the original objective.

The Art of Software Creation: A Holistic Approach

Developing reliable software isn't merely writing lines of script; it's a complex art that demands a integrated approach. This methodology encompasses far more than just check here the developmental aspects. It requires a deep understanding of the user's desires, the business goals, and the broader ecosystem in which the software will exist. A truly effective application emerges from careful planning, involving stakeholders at every stage of the development process. Considerations should include user interface, scalability for future advancement, and maintainability to ensure ongoing benefit. Ultimately, the formation of software represents a mixture of technical skill and thoughtful consideration, resulting in a application that effectively tackles a specific challenge.
